iPhone 3GS launch in Atlantic City
ATLANTIC CITY -- There were about 20 people waiting in line when I arrived for the iPhone 3GS launch at the Apple Store at The Pier in Atlantic City at 8:00 a.m.
Although the outgoing message on the The Pier's voicemail said that the store would open at 8:00 a.m., they opened an hour early and staffers started taking the first iPhone customers at 7:00 a.m.
About 20 people were waiting in a line which formed outside at the right employee entrance by the 7:00 a.m. opening. Apple was putting people into two lines, once for those that had "reserved" an iPhone 3GS in advance and one for those that had "pre-qualified" online. By the time I arrived at 8:00 I the line was still about 20 deep and staffers were allowing anxious customers in via the outside service entrance at the Pier two or three at a time.
The line moved relatively fast and I was in possession of my brand-spankin'-new 32GB iPhone 3GS (in black) after a little less than 30 minutes of waiting.
